Olivier Eager To ‘End Season On A High’

IrishRugby.ie caught up with South Africa centre Wynand Olivier, who will partner Jaque Fourie in the tourists’ team for Saturday’s clash with Ireland. He talked about Ireland’s strength in depth and recent form, his analysis of his opposite number Paddy Wallace and how he is looking forward to his first start for the ‘Boks since the third Test against the Lions in July.
